Day 4:
Sighisoara Walking Tour & Biertan (UNESCO World Heritage Site) - Time at Leisure
Before starting your walking tour of old Sighisoara attend an informal talk on Vlad the Impaler - Dracula, what is truth and what is fiction (by the tour guide). Sighisoara is one of a kind. It was developed by the German settlers as of late 12th century. It stands on a network of tunnels and catacombs and, according to one version of the myth; this is where the Pied Piper brought the children of Hamelin after their ungrateful parents refused to pay him his due. The walking tour includes the two squares of the Citadel (Upper Town), the Scholars' Staircase, the House with Antler, the Tower with Clock (climb up for a great view), the Torture Chamber and the Weapon Museum. Visit the exquisite Spoonman Exhibition of Transylvanian Arts & Crafts. Sighisoara is the place where the Vlad the Impaler Dracula was born in 1431. The Birthplace is the oldest civilian building in town and one of the main tourist attractions. Then drive to the fortified church of Biertan, a UNESCO World Heritage Site for a visit of the former Seat of the Lutheran Bishops. With its three betls of fortification this is the most impressive fortified church in the country. Opportunity for a short walk in the village. Return to Sighisoara’s Upper Town to further explore it on own.
